About Domestic Violence Law in Sachseln, Switzerland

Domestic violence is a serious issue addressed by Swiss law, including in the municipality of Sachseln, in the canton of Obwalden. Domestic violence refers to any physical, psychological, or sexual abuse that occurs within a family or intimate relationship. This includes violence against spouses, partners, children, or other household members. In Switzerland, domestic violence is recognized as a crime, and victims are entitled to legal protection and support. Swiss authorities emphasize prevention, intervention, and victim support in cases of domestic violence.

Local Laws Overview

In Sachseln, domestic violence cases are addressed according to both Swiss federal legislation and cantonal laws. The Swiss Criminal Code criminalizes acts of violence, threats, and coercion committed against family members or intimate partners. Police in Obwalden have the authority to remove the perpetrator from the home for a certain period if immediate danger exists. Victims can apply for protection orders and emergency shelter. The law also mandates cooperation between police, social services, and courts to ensure the safety and well-being of victims, including minors. Furthermore, proceedings related to child custody and visitation consider domestic violence as a critical factor. Confidentiality of victims is respected, and support services are available at the cantonal level.

Frequently Asked Questions

What qualifies as domestic violence in Sachseln?

Domestic violence includes physical, emotional, psychological, or sexual abuse occurring within a household or intimate partnership. Threats, intimidation, and controlling behavior may also qualify.

What should I do if I am a victim of domestic violence?

If you are in immediate danger, contact the police at 117. You can also seek help from local support organizations or a lawyer to discuss protection measures and your legal options.

Can the police remove an abusive person from my home?

Yes, under Swiss law the police can order an offender to leave the shared home for a set period if there is a serious threat to your safety. This measure can be extended by court order.

How do I apply for a protection order?

You can apply for a protection or restraining order through the local court in Sachseln. A lawyer or local victim support service can assist you with the process.

Will my children be protected in domestic violence situations?

Yes, Swiss laws place significant emphasis on the safety and welfare of children. Authorities can take protective measures to safeguard children from harm.

What happens if I am accused of domestic violence?

You may face criminal charges, removal from your home, or restrictions on contact with the victim. It is strongly advised to seek legal representation to understand your rights and defense options.

Can I get emergency shelter?

Yes, there are shelters and safe accommodations available in the region for victims and their children. Local social services or victim support organizations can provide referrals.

Are proceedings confidential?

Yes, authorities and support organizations treat domestic violence cases with confidentiality, protecting the privacy of victims and witnesses.

Can domestic violence affect divorce or child custody cases?

Yes, evidence of domestic violence is considered by courts when deciding on divorce terms and child custody arrangements to prioritize the safety of victims and children.

Is legal aid available for domestic violence cases?

If you cannot afford a lawyer, you may be eligible for legal aid in the canton of Obwalden. Contact the local legal aid office for more details.
